Striking case and bracelet design crafted by the legendary jeweler Gilbert Albert. A celebrated Swiss artist and designer, Gilbert Albert lent his exceptional vision and craftsmanship to several esteemed watchmakers, creating distinctive cases and bracelets that merged contemporary design with time-honored techniques. Albert began his career at Patek Philippe in the 1950s, with the iconic ref. 3424 standing out among his early works. He later joined Omega in the 1960s, where he continued to develop a unique collection of cocktail watches for the brand.

The featured piece from 1972 highlights a 9 carat octagonal case that flows seamlessly into a finely detailed X-pattern bracelet. Impressively, both the case and bracelet remain unpolished, preserving the original design intent of Gilbert Albert.

The champagne-toned dial features sleek baton hour markers and a raised gold Omega emblem, while the Caliber 485 movement inside runs with precision, ensuring dependable timekeeping.

The clasp continues the bracelet’s intricate motif and includes the Omega logo. It offers three adjustable settings, allowing for a tailored fit on the wrist.
